Newly surfaced video footage reveals a car racing at high speed moments before a violent crash in Norwalk that ejected two people from the vehicle. The clip, obtained by local authorities, adds crucial detail to the investigation of the incident, which left both occupants seriously injured. The footage is now central to understanding the sequence of events that led to the dramatic ejection.
What the Video Captures
The video, recorded by a nearby surveillance camera, shows the vehicle barreling down the street well above the posted speed limit in the seconds preceding the crash. According to preliminary reports, the car lost control at a curve, slammed into a fixed object, and flipped, causing both occupants to be thrown from the cabin. The footage has been shared with investigators, who are analyzing the speed and trajectory to determine the exact cause.
Witnesses at the scene described hearing a loud engine roar before the impact, followed by a deafening crash. Emergency responders arrived within minutes and found both individuals on the ground, prompting immediate airlift to a nearby trauma center. Their current conditions remain unknown, though officials have not ruled out the possibility of life-threatening injuries.

Speed and Ejection Mechanics
Vehicle ejection is one of the most dangerous outcomes in a crash, often leading to severe head and spinal injuries. When a car flips at high speed, the force can easily overcome the friction of a seatbelt if not properly fastened, or in some cases, even with a belt, if the vehicle's structure fails. In this incident, the fact that both occupants were ejected suggests they were likely unrestrained.
Safety experts emphasize that seatbelts reduce the risk of fatal injury by up to 50%, and ejection is virtually eliminated when belts are used correctly.
